Frequently Asked Questions
The ISEE-Lower Level Math section tests fundamental math concepts typically covered in grades 5-6, including arithmetic, basic algebra, geometry, and word problems. For students in Harrisburg preparing for independent school entrance exams, the test emphasizes both procedural skills (like computation) and conceptual understanding—knowing not just how to solve a problem, but why the solution works. Tutors can help you master these foundations and develop problem-solving strategies that go beyond memorization.
Many students struggle with multi-step word problems, where they need to identify what's being asked and plan their approach before calculating. Others find geometry and spatial reasoning tricky, or feel anxious when they encounter unfamiliar problem formats. Word problems require you to translate English into math, plan a solution strategy, and execute calculations—multiple steps where confusion can creep in. Tutors help by teaching you a consistent approach: underline key information, identify the question, break multi-step problems into smaller chunks, and verify your answer makes sense. With practice and feedback on your reasoning (not just your final answer), word problems shift from intimidating to manageable.
